About the Team

Travel Partnerships and Advertising (TPA) helps partners deliver excellent traveler and B2B experiences, driving growth for them and the EG marketplace through competitive supply, a valued advertising and travel media network, and affiliate solutions.

The Associate Account Manager - Partner Success position is part of the Vacation Rentals (VR) division of TPA, which leads the holiday rental industry with more than two million places to stay in 190 countries. Consumer brands, including Stayz in Australia and Bookabach in New Zealand, make it easy to find and book the perfect beach house, cottage, or apartment for any getaway.

VR's mission is to make every holiday rental in the world available to every traveler through our online marketplace. We're committed to helping families and friends find the perfect holiday rental to create unforgettable travel memories together.

Role Overview

An Associate Account Manager for Property Owners is key to building and maintaining strong and high-performing relationships with our holiday rental owners/partners. The primary responsibility is to ensure that our owner inventory is competitive, attractive, and relevant for Expedia Group's fast-growing global traveler base. You will work hand-in-hand with holiday rental owners to improve performance by coaching and influencing partners to take actions that improve booking conversions.

In this role, you will:

* Drive value for partners and improve their experience with a 'traveler-centric' mindset. Propose enhancements based on partners' unique situations and structure solutions that add partner value, enthusiastically creating "win-win" situations by suggesting our products, features, services, or solutions. Fundamentally, you'll be a relationship manager who establishes and maintains positive, trusting relationships with partners.

* Establish performance goals with partners, develop action plans, and secure commitment for adoption/usage.

* Optimize content, rate, and availability to maximize booking conversion.

* Develop and sustain strong customer relationships by providing relevant data insights and direction.

* Secure additional inventory over high-demand and compression periods to satisfy traveler demand.

* Educate partners on the self-service features available on our platform.

* Keep abreast of key demand/supply indicators, economic data, trends, and competitive information within the designated strategic market.

* Promote relevant products to existing customers.

Employment opportunities and job offers at Expedia Group will always come from Expedia Group's Talent Acquisition and hiring teams. Never provide sensitive, personal information to someone unless you're confident who the recipient is. Expedia Group does not extend job offers via email or any other messaging tools to individuals with whom we have not made prior contact. Our email domain is @expediagroup.com. The official website to find and apply for job openings at Expedia Group is careers.expediagroup.com/jobs.
